    Default Strange Problem with Mitsubishi Meldas 500

    Hi, I have a milling machine equipped with Mitsubishi Meldas 500 and I have a very strange problem. The machine starts properly without any error. All axes are working without error and I can move them but... when I start the operation of AUTO ZERO then it gives M01 OPERATION ERROR 0102 which means that the feed override is at 0 but it's not on 0! I tested the rotating selectors switch and it's working properly there is no problem with the feed override selector switch. Does anyone has any idea what can hold the AUTO ZERO function? I'm trying to find the ladder but for Meldas 500 is impossible, I cannot see it so I'm blind on this problem. I need help!!!!Thank you in advance.
